Lambourne Road - BN1 7FD
Key Street Insights
Lambourne Road is a residential street with 25 addresses.
It ranks as the 330th largest and 377th most expensive of the 742 streets in the BN1 area. The most common property type is a mid-century house built between 1936 and 1979.
The street contains a total of 25 properties: 18 houses and 7 other properties.
